The aim of the experiment To determine the molar mass of carbon dioxide in three different ways; 1) using the Ideal Gas Law equation, 2) using the molar volume of a gas at NTP, 3) using the relative density to air Equipment CO2 tank, a flask with a rubber stopper (300 cm 3), technical balance, measuring cylinder (250 cm3), thermometer, barometer. Method 1. Determine the mass (m1= mflask+stopper+air) of the dry flask with a rubber stopper by weighing on a technical balance. Draw a line on the flask at the bottom edge of the stopper in order to measure the volume of the flask in step 5. 2. Fill the flask with carbon dioxide gas. Direct the gas from the CO 2 tank into the flask for about 7-8 minutes. The tip of the hose has to be in the bottom but not very closely against the bottom. Tundra Tundra is the world's youngest biome. It was formed 10 000 years ago. Located at latitudes 55° to 70° North. Almost all tundras are located in the Northern Hemisphere, encircling arctic desert and extending south to the coniferous forests of the taiga. The ecotone (ecological boundary region) between the tundra and the forest is known as the tree line or timberline. Tundra comes from the Finnish word tunturi, meaning treeless plain. It is noted for its frost-moulded landscapes, extremely low temperatures, little precipitation, poor nutrients, and short growing seasons. Dead organic material functions as a nutrient pool. The two major nutrients are nitrogen and phosphorus. Nitrogen is created by biological fixation, and phosphorus is created by precipitation. Acid Rain Acid rain is any precipitation that is unusually acidic. It possesses elevated levels of hydrogen ions(it has low pH level). Acid rain is caused by emissions of carbon dioxide, sulfur dioxide and nitrogen oxides, which react with water molecules. Distilled water(doesn't contain CO 2), has pH level 7. Liquids with pH level less than 7 are acidic, liquids with pH level greater than 7 are alkaline. Unpolluted rain has a pH level over 5.7, so it is slightly acidic. Affected areas Places significantly impacted by acid rain around the globe include most of eastern Europe from Poland northward into Scandinavia, the eastern third of the United States and southeastern Canada. Õhk, mille koostises on 1% süsihappegaasi, teeb mõned inimesed uimaseks, 7­10% kontsentratsioon põhjustab peapööritust, peavalu, nägemis- ja kuulmishäireid ning mõne minuti või tunni jooksul teadvusekaotust. Süsihappegaas on kasvuhoonegaas, sest laseb läbi nähtavat valgust, aga neelab infrapunast kiirgust.5 3 https://et.wikipedia.org/wiki/S%C3%BCsihappegaas (03.02.16) 4 https://turismimojud.wikispaces.com/CO2 (05.02.16) 5 http://www.lenntech.com/carbon-dioxide.htm (05.02.16) 6 3.1. Süsihappegaasi ajalugu Süsihappegaas oli üks esimesi gaase, mida kirjeldati õhust erineva ainena. 17. sajandil täheldas flaami keemik Jan Baptist van Helmont, et puusöe põletamisel kinnises anumas on järelejääva tuha mass väiksem kui algse söe mass. Venus Venus has been known since prehistoric times and the planet is named after Venus, the Roman goddess of love. It is the second-closest planet to the Sun and it`s often called Earth's "sister planet," because the two are similar in size, gravity, and bulk composition. Because of these similarities, it was thought that Venus might even have life. Venus is also called the Morning star or the Evening star, because it reaches its brightness shortly before sunrise or shortly after sunset. It is the brightest object in the sky except for the Sun and the Moon. During the last few years the scientists have found that Venus and Earth are very different. It has no oceans and is surrounded by a heavy atmosphere composed mainly of carbon dioxide with virtually no water vapor. Hingamine, põlemine ja fotosüntees Hingamine Hapnik (O2) võtab osa paljudest looduses toimuvatest nähtustest. Kõik elus organismid, sealjuures bakterid, hingavad. Vaid üksikud bakteriliigid, kes elavad veekogude põhjamudas, sõnnikukuhilas või sügaval mullas, ei kasuta hapniku. Neile on hapnik mürgine ja õhu kätte sattudes nad hukkuvad. Inimesed ja paljud teised organismid kasutavad hingamiseks õhus sisalduvat hapnikku. Kui võrdleme sissehingatud ja väljahingatud õhu koostist, siis selgub, et sissehingatavas õhus on rohkem hapnikku kui väljahingatavas õhus. Väljahingatavas õhus on rohkem süsihappegaasi (carbon dioxide). Hapnikku kasutab organism elutegevuseks, energia saamiseks, liikumiseks, rakkude ülesehitamiseks. Ainevahetusel tekkinud süsihappegaas eraldub väljahingatava õhuga. Acid rain is rain or any other form of precipitation that is unusually acidic. It can have harmful effects on plants, aquatic animals, and infrastructure through the process of wet deposition. Acid rain is caused by emissions of compounds of ammonium, carbon, nitrogen, and sulfur which react with the water molecules in the atmosphere to produce acids. Governments have made efforts since the 1970s to reduce the production of sulfuric oxides into the Earth's atmosphere with positive results Since the Industrial Revolution, emissions of sulfur dioxide and nitrogen oxides to the atmosphere have increased.[2][3] In 1852, Robert Angus Smith was the first to show the relationship between acid rain and atmospheric pollution in Manchester, England.[4] Though acidic rain was discovered in 1852, it was not until the late 1960s that scientists began widely observing and studying the phenomenon. GLOBAL WARMING Global warming is the observed century-scale rise in the average temperature of Earth's climate system. Since 1971, 90% of the increased energy has been stored in the oceans, mostly in the 0 to 700m region. Despite the oceans' dominant role in energy storage, the term "global warming" is also used to refer to increases in average temperature of the air and sea at Earth's surface. Since the early 20th century, the global air and sea surface temperature has increased about 0.8 °C (1.4 °F), with about two-thirds of the increase occurring since 1980.Each of the last three decades has been successively warmer at the Earth's surface than any preceding decade since 1850. Formaldehyde Formaldehyde is a colorless, flammable gas at room temperature. It has a pungent, distinct odor and may cause a burning sensation to the eyes, nose, and lungs at high concentrations. Formaldehyde is also known as methanal, methylene oxide, oxymethylene, methylaldehyde, and oxomethane. Formaldehyde can react with many other chemicals, and it will break down into methanol (wood alcohol) and carbon monoxide at very high temperatures. Formaldehyde is naturally produced in very small amounts in our bodies as a part of our normal, everyday metabolism and causes us no harm. It can also be found in the air that we breathe at home and at work, in the food we eat, and in some products that we put on our skin. Tallinn 2013 Ott Speek Subject: English Geodesy Study group: GI-21b PETROLEUM PRESENTATION Petroleum (L. petroleum, from Greek: Πέτρα (rock) + Latin: oleum (oil) is a naturally occurring flammable liquid consisting of a complex mixture of hydrocarbons of various molecular weights and other liquid organic compounds, that are found in geologic formations beneath the Earth's surface. The name Petroleum covers both naturally occurring unprocessed crude oils and petroleum products that are made up of refined crude oil. A fossil fuel, it is formed when large quantities of dead organisms, usually zooplankton and algae, are buried underneath sedimentary rock and undergo intense heat and pressure. Petroleum is recovered mostly through oil drilling.
